[Bug 942789] Re: suspend/wireless_before_suspend tries to disconnect an inactive device

2012-03-13 Thread Brendan Donegan
Having got to the bottom of this issue, this is actually not a bug in
Checkbox, but the nmcli tool used to drive the test. This:

Error: Device 'eth0' (/org/freedesktop/NetworkManager/Devices/1)
disconnecting failed: This device is not active

is not what is causing the test to fail. This is:

** WARNING **: handle_property_changed: failed to update property 
'active-connections' of object type NMClient. Error: Timeout 90 sec
expired.

and it's (mostly) unrelated.

We can still change the test so that it doesn't try and do pointless
stuff like deactivating already inactive connections but that isn't the
crux of the issue and isn't a considerable problem.

[Bug 947366] Re: [Lenovo e320] - cpu_scaling_test Fails

2012-03-06 Thread Brendan Donegan
In this case it looks like the test passed, so the failure may be a one
off. The outcome of this test is influenced by the system load at the
time the test is run, and we try our best to limit this effect. For
example the 'nice -n 20' runs the cpu_scaling_test with a very low
'niceness' level, meaning that it tries to steal all the cpu cycles. If
there are a lot of other 'not nice' processes running at the same time
this could impact the outcome. It's important not to do *any* other
tasks on a test system while Checkbox is running or else the outcomes
could be influenced by them.

Run the command again and immediately after, echo $?. This will tell you
the result - do this five times and if the result is always 0 then close
the bug as Invalid.

[Bug 848553] Re: suspend-test doesn't detect suspends

2012-02-23 Thread Brendan Donegan
The suspend_test script is deprecated, in fact you will find it's not
used by any job in the Ubuntu Friendly tests. To test suspend as we do
for Ubuntu Friendly you should use:

sudo /usr/share/checkbox/scripts/sleep_test -d

In theory we should remove the script which is no longer used. In
practice an SRU to simply remove script is not worth the effort.
